Default need help with 2 bar hardware

Okay, after doing a fair amount of research I ordered the 2 bar map, and I'm up to that point in my install. But, the connector on the new 2 bar is very different than the stock one. No biggie, I ordered the connector for the new sensor. But I just have a feeling that this is not right.

The map sensor is p/n 12569241. Is this the right map? Now, if I splice the new connector on, which wires go where? And this new connector even needs some modification to make it fit!! Somebody please tell me I have the right stuff!!!

I know that gm PN 12580698 is a 2 bar, direct replacement for a truck manifold, and I think it works on the car manifold as well.

Nope, the one on the left is the stock one and the one on the right is the 2 bar. I believe it is for a Saturn Ion Redline, supercharged. Plugged right in, but had to rescale for it with efilive.
It was like $45 from GMPartsdirect.com

If you have the in-line, 3-pin, MetriPak style MAP sensor like shown above, the connector is the same, but is keyed differently and is usually a different color. You can take an Exacto knife and carefully trim the key out so yours will fit. That should get you up and running quickly.
